Northern Ireland competed at the 1986 Commonwealth Games in Edinburgh, Scotland, from 24 July to 2 August 1986.[1]

Northern Ireland finished 7th in the medal table with two gold medals, four silver medals and nine bronze medals.[2]

The Northern Irish team was named on 16 June 1986 and consisted of 80 athletes.[3][4]
